If 3 2 sin 2 α - 1 , 14 and 3 4 - 2 sin 2 α are the first three terms of an A.P. for some α , then the sixth term of this A.P. is
Options
- A66
- B81
- C65
- D78
Correct answer
A. 66
Step-by-step solution
If a ,   b ,   c are in AP, then b is A.M of a   &   c . ∴   2   b = a + c ⇒ 28 = 3 2 sin 2 α - 1 + 3 4 - 2 sin 2 α Putting, 3 2 sin 2 α = x we get, 28 = x 3 + 81 x ⇒ x 2 - 84 x + 243 = 0 ⇒ ( x - 3 ) ( x - 81 ) = 0 ∴   3 2 sin 2 α = 3 or 3 4 sin 2 α = 1 2 , ∵ sin 2 α ≠ 2 Terms are 1 , 14 , 27 , … … then T 6 = 1 + 5 ( 13 ) = 66
